Powderkeg
147 St John's Hill
43 Recomendado por los habitantes de la zona
British food, Victorian themed, has great cocktails and beers – a bit pricey for dinner but a great place for brunch on the weekends – try to get a table in the back room under the skylight!

The Falcon
2A St John's Hill
26 Recomendado por los habitantes de la zona
Right next to Clapham Junction train station, this is a typical English pub, they’ve just renovated the whole thing and they have a brilliant beer selection, the food is decent and traditional.

The Roundhouse
2 North Side Wandsworth Common
23 Recomendado por los habitantes de la zona
A typical English pub with a great ambiance. Nice for a late afternoon pint, good local beers on draught, decent pub food (the Duck Scotch Egg is a must!)
